Output baf8564a27e99d88b9e77e1027ebbc2d909e25e6ea06feb33b6b6ba9b822888e:1

value
2552779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a89ae5bd15a9704039eb59df3977622e71640b1f OP_EQUAL
address
3H4X1ESB79PRHEdWDCS1saWXSTe4diMEa4
transaction
baf8564a27e99d88b9e77e1027ebbc2d909e25e6ea06feb33b6b6ba9b822888e
confirmations
444407
spent
true